It took minor fab work to put a foreman 350 rear end in it. It has to be from an old school 88ish and you have to fit the 300 swing arm to the rear axle housing on the 350. These rear chunks are alot tougher and can be found on ebay for cheap. The Rancher , 400, 450, and 500 foreman will not work the rotation and gear ratio is wrong. Price all depends on how much you find the used parts for. I have about 300 +- in the back end of his.
